Job description
This position is focused on efficiently transforming and prepping large datasets for Onpoint's Analytics staff and clients. The Analytics Engineer plays a key role in designing and maintaining Onpoint's most complex data transformation logic. The successful candidate will acquire a diverse set of skills in data management, leveraging tools such as SQL, Tableau, python, and many AWS Services to effectively cleanse and enhance hundreds of terabytes of healthcare data for Onpoint's client base. The successful candidate in this role must be detail oriented and able to work on multiple projects at a time., * Use industry best practices to extract and transform data from data lakes using Spark SQL, python, and AWS services such as AWS Glue.
